Urban Outfitters is looking for a proactive individual with commercial fashion retail experience to manage product classes and ensure quality across our garment lines. You will communicate effectively with our global supply chain and analyze quality reports to enhance customer satisfaction.

The ideal candidate will possess deep knowledge in fabric, garment construction, and strong technical skills in drawing and pattern cutting. Join us to be part of a creative and inclusive team aiming for excellence in fashion.
